Identification and determination of polycyclic aromatic hydrocarbons (PAHs) in Diesel exhaust in the working environment and assessment of workers’ occupational exposure to these suspected human carcinogens were the aim of this experimental investigation.

The range of exposure factors calculated on the basis of 9 individual PAH concentrations determined in personal air samples shows that time-averaged concentration of these compounds did not exceed the Polish Maximum Admissible Concentration (MAC) value for PAHs, that is, 2 μg·m–3. The highest concentrations of PAHs were determined in the breathing zone of forklift operators. The maximum exposure factor was 0.427 μg·m–3 (about 1/4 of MAC).  相似文献

Five variants of mixtures of different synthetic fibres at different area ratios were manufactured into needled nonwovens intended to be used as a filtering material for respiratory protection. Two variants were produced according to an earlier patent, and the contents of the other three was completely new. Samples of the nonwovens were tested for sodium chloride particles penetration and for breathing resistance. The results showed that one variant of a nonwoven, designated PP/PPFM, had very valuable filtering properties and that those properties were stable in time.  相似文献

The aim of this study was to present the situation of women with disabilities on the labour market. Women with disabilities suffer from social and professional discrimination. They are discriminated because of their gender and disability. The Q1 Labour Force Participation Study (2013) showed that, in Poland, labour force participation for men and women with disabilities was 29.4% and 14.7%, respectively, while the unemployment rate was 16.1% for men and 17.2% for women. Quarterly information on employment, unemployment and economic inactivity was gathered from a Labour Force Survey in the first quarter of 2013; data from the Ministry of Labour and Social Policy were also included. The participants of the survey were 15 years old or older; they were members of a sample household. The methodology was based on definitions recommended by the International Labour Office and Eurostat. It is important that women with disabilities are substantially less professionally active, while the unemployment rate for them is only slightly higher.  相似文献

The skin is the part of the human body most vulnerable to ultraviolet (UV) radiation. The spectrum of the negative effects of UV radiation on the skin ranges from acute erythema to carcinogenesis. Between these extreme conditions, there are other common skin lesions, e.g.,photoageing. The aim of this study was to assess the skin for signs of photoageing in a group of 52 men occupationally exposed to natural UV radiation. There were 2 types of examinations: an examination of skin condition (moisture, elasticity, sebum, porosity, smoothness, discolourations and wrinkles) with a device for diagnosing the skin, and a dermatological examination. The results of both examinations revealed a higher percentage of skin characteristics typical for photoageing in outdoor workers compared to the general population.  相似文献

Purpose. The aim of this article was to check whether mindfulness-based stress reduction (MBSR) is an effective intervention in reducing work-related stress in the case of workers in a copper mine. Methods. Sixty six employees were randomized to the experimental group (32 participants) or to the control group (34 participants). Work-related stress was measured using the job content questionnaire (JCQ) and mental health was measured using the general health questionnaire (GHQ-28) Experimental manipulation was 40-h MBSR training. Results. Multivariate repeated-measures analysis of variance revealed a significant increase of JCQ decision latitude (F?=?17.36, p?<?0.001) and social support (supervisor F?=?9.00, p?<?0.004; coworker F?=?5.61, p?<?0.020), and a significant decrease in GHQ-28 anxiety (F?=?5.28, p?<?0.079) and depression (F?=?3.95, p?<?0.048) due to the intervention. Conclusions. The study confirms that MBSR can be effective in reducing stress resulting from the external risk (and/or imagined fear) of losing one’s health or life. The use of MBSR could be recommended in health and safety activities in difficult and dangerous work conditions, such as mining, to promote workers’ well-being.  相似文献

We present a new protocol to study fluxes of radionuclides and other xenobiotics in saprophytic fungi. This simple method has successfully been used to evaluate transport of radiocesium in hyphae of Pleurotus eryngii and its translocation to fruitbodies.  相似文献

Ground level air pollution, especially fine particulate matter (PM2.5), has been associated with a number of adverse health effects. The dispersion of PM2.5 through the atmosphere depends on several mutually connected anthropogenic, geophysical and meteorological parameters, all of which are affected by climate change. This study examines how projected climate change would affect population exposure to PM2.5 air pollution in Poland. Population exposure to PM2.5 in Poland was estimated for three decades: the 1990s, 2040s and 2090s. Future climate conditions were projected by Regional Climate Model RegCM (Beta), forced by the general atmospheric circulation model ECHAM5. The dispersion of PM2.5 was simulated with chemical transport model CAMx version 4.40. Population exposure estimates of PM2.5 were 18.3, 17.2 and 17.1 μg/m3 for the 1990s, 2040s and 2090s, respectively. PM2.5 air pollution was estimated to cause approximately 39,800 premature deaths in the population of Poland in the year 2000. Our results indicate that in Poland, climate change may reduce the levels of exposure to anthropogenic particulate air pollution in future decades and that this reduction will reduce adverse health effects caused by the air pollution.  相似文献

The presented results include decade of monitoring of the Vistula Lagoon waters and have been supplemented by the determination of chlorinated compounds, as well as on concentrations of polychlorinated dibenzo-p-dioxins and dibenzofurans (PCDD/Fs) in the sedimentation zone. Monitoring of river waters entering the Polish part of the lagoon and the lagoon waters confirmed the presence of plant protection chemical; the largest contributors has lindane (34%) and DDTtotal (21%); the same as for sediments were dominate lindane (19%) and DDTtotal (14%) within pp-DDT isomer dominate (13%). In the lagoon water, PCDD/Fs were determined within a range of 1.5–5.6 ng dm?3, leading to average toxicity of 0.18?±?0.13 ng TEQ·dm?3. In sediments, their concentrations fell within a range of 22.7–405.7 ng kg?1 dw and the average toxicity of the lagoon sediments was set at 5.00?±?1.98 ng TEQ·kg?1 dw. Both in water and sediments, the greatest share among PCDD/Fs has octa-chlorodibenzodioxin. Due to the hydromorphological conditions of the lagoon, the waters are mixed to the bottom causing the surface layer of sediment to become remobilized—this is suggested as the key factor when it comes to water recontamination and increased access of POPs to marine organisms.  相似文献

The aim of the study was to investigate the transfer of toxic metals from honeybee workers (Apis mellifera L.) to bee honey in relation to the ecological state of the environment. The materials of the study consisted of samples of honeybee bodies and varietal honeys taken from the same apiary located in three areas: R1—urbanized (16), R2—ecologically clean (16) and R3—industrialized (15) of south-eastern Poland. The contents of 14 elements in all tested samples, including toxic metals (Cd, Pb, Hg, Al, Ni, Tl) as well as bioelements (K, Mg, Ca, Mn, Fe, Zn, Cu, Se), were analysed by the ICP-OES method with prior microwave mineralization. The concentrations of the majority of the studied elements, excluding aluminum and lead, were significantly higher in bee bodies than in honey samples (P?<?0.05). The pollution of bee bodies by toxic metals was dependent on the environmental cleanliness, and the most pollution was observed in the industrialized area. The bee body was the most effective barrier for Cd and Tl transfer to the honey, while the level of Ni was similar in both tested materials. The Al concentration was significantly higher in honey than bee bodies (14.81?±?24.69 and 6.51?±?5.83 mg kg?1, respectively), which suggests the possibility of secondary contamination of honey. The greatest sensitivity to heavy metal pollution was observed in honeydew honey compared to nectar honeys (P?<?0.05). It was proved for the first time that bees work as biofilters for toxic metals and prevent honey contamination.  相似文献
